版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
2022届FPGA秋招提前批笔试面试预测题库及答案
一、单项选择题(每题2分,共20分)1.FPGA的基本结构不包括以下哪项?()A.逻辑单元B.存储单元C.布线资源D.微处理器2.以下哪种编程语言常用于FPGA设计?()A.CB.VerilogC.PythonD.Java3.FPGA的配置模式不包括以下哪项?()A.被动串行配置B.主动并行配置C.主从配置D.在线配置4.在FPGA设计中,以下哪种结构用于实现数据的缓存?()A.FIFOB.RAMC.ROMD.PLL5.FPGA的工作频率主要取决于以下哪个因素?()A.逻辑单元的速度B.存储单元的速度C.布线资源的速度D.以上都是6.以下哪种工具常用于FPGA的综合?()A.QuartusIIB.VivadoC.ModelSimD.ISE7.在FPGA设计中,以下哪种约束用于指定引脚的电气特性?()A.时序约束B.面积约束C.电源约束D.I/O约束8.FPGA的可重构性是指以下哪种特性?()A.可以随时修改设计B.可以在不同的应用中使用C.可以根据需要添加或删除功能D.以上都是9.以下哪种技术可以提高FPGA的性能?()A.流水线技术B.并行处理技术C.资源共享技术D.以上都是10.FPGA的应用领域不包括以下哪项?()A.通信B.计算机C.汽车电子D.航空航天二、填空题(每题2分,共20分)1.FPGA的全称是________________。2.逻辑单元是FPGA的核心组成部分,它主要由________________和________________组成。3.FPGA的存储单元包括________________和________________。4.布线资源是连接逻辑单元和存储单元的通道,它包括________________和________________。5.FPGA的配置模式包括________________、________________、________________和________________。6.常用的FPGA设计流程包括________________、________________、________________、________________和________________。7.时序约束是指对FPGA设计中的________________和________________进行约束,以保证设计的正确性和性能。8.I/O约束是指对FPGA的________________和________________进行约束,以保证设计的正确性和性能。9.FPGA的可重构性主要体现在________________、________________和________________三个方面。10.FPGA的性能主要包括________________、________________和________________三个方面。三、判断题(每题2分,共20分)1.FPGA是一种专用集成电路。()2.Verilog是一种硬件描述语言。()3.FPGA的配置数据可以存储在ROM中。()4.FIFO是一种先进先出的数据缓存器。()5.PLL是一种锁相环,用于提高FPGA的时钟频率。()6.QuartusII是一款常用的FPGA开发工具。()7.时序约束可以提高FPGA的设计性能。()8.I/O约束可以提高FPGA的设计性能。()9.FPGA的可重构性可以降低设计成本。()10.FPGA的应用领域非常广泛。()四、简答题(每题5分,共20分)1.简述FPGA的工作原理。2.比较FPGA和ASIC的优缺点。3.简述FPGA设计中的流水线技术。4.简述FPGA设计中的资源共享技术。五、讨论题(每题5分,共20分)1.如何提高FPGA的设计效率?2.如何解决FPGA设计中的时序问题?3.如何选择适合的FPGA器件?4.如何进行FPGA的验证?答案:一、单项选择题1.D2.B3.C4.A5.D6.A7.D8.D9.D10.D二、填空题1.现场可编程门阵列2.查找表寄存器3.SRAMROM4.全局布线资源局部布线资源5.被动串行配置主动并行配置主从配置在线配置6.设计输入功能仿真综合布局布线时序仿真7.时序路径时钟信号8.输入输出引脚电气特性9.硬件可重构软件可重构软硬件协同重构10.处理速度资源利用率功耗三、判断题1.×2.√3.√4.√5.√6.√7.√8.√9.√10.√四、简答题1.FPGA的工作原理是通过编程将用户设计的逻辑功能映射到FPGA的内部逻辑单元和布线资源上,从而实现特定的功能。2.FPGA的优点是灵活性高、可重构性强、开发周期短、成本低;缺点是性能相对较低、功耗较高、资源利用率有限。ASIC的优点是性能高、功耗低、资源利用率高;缺点是开发周期长、成本高、灵活性差。3.流水线技术是指将一个复杂的运算或操作分成多个子步骤,每个子步骤在不同的时钟周期内完成,从而提高系统的处理速度。4.资源共享技术是指在FPGA设计中,合理地利用有限的资源,避免资源的浪费,从而提高系统的资源利用率。五、讨论题1.提高FPGA设计效率的方法包括:采用高效的设计流程、合理的模块划分、使用自动化工具、进行代码优化等。2.解决FPGA设计中的时序问题的方法包括:进行时序分析、添加时序约束、优化设计结构、采用流水线技术等。3.选择适合的FPGA器件的方法包括:根据设计需求确定器件的规模、速度、功耗等参数,
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 医务科门诊工作制度
- 医疗机主要工作制度
- 医院GDR工作制度
- 医院合疗办工作制度
- 医院配药室工作制度
- 协同工作组工作制度
- 南开区政府工作制度
- 卫生院公卫工作制度
- 卫生院采样工作制度
- 厂区医疗站工作制度
- 绍兴市2026公安机关辅警招聘考试笔试题库(含答案)
- 银屑病诊疗指南(2026年版)基层规范化诊疗
- 2026年中国超高丁腈氢化丁腈橡胶市场数据研究及竞争策略分析报告
- “大展宏图”系列研究二:特朗普如何重构石油美元2.0体系
- 2026贵州茅台集团校园招聘89人考试参考试题及答案解析
- 2026年及未来5年市场数据中国离子色谱仪行业市场深度研究及投资策略研究报告
- 2025年陕西国防工业职业技术学院单招职业技能考试试题及答案解析
- 介入治疗围手术期疼痛管理专家共识2026
- 2025年青岛地铁校园招聘笔试题及答案
- 2025年扬州市职业大学单招职业技能考试题库附答案解析
- 三国空城计课件
评论
0/150
提交评论